The book presents a detailed examination of the evidence provided by Thomas Irving, the inspector general of exports and imports for Great Britain, during a select committee inquiry into the slave trade. It captures the historical context and insights from 1791, reflecting the complexities surrounding the issue of slavery and trade practices at that time. This high-quality reprint preserves the original content, offering readers a glimpse into the perspectives and testimonies that shaped discussions on this critical moral and economic issue.
